A magical classic novel from the Godmother of British fantasy, Diana Wynne Jones.

On the surface, Great Aunt Maria seems like a harmless old lady.

But when Mig and her family go to visit, they soon learn that Aunt Maria rules Cranbury-on-Sea with a rod of sweetness that’s tougher than iron and deadlier than poison. Life revolves around women’s tea parties, while grey-suited men behave like zombies and clone-like children fade into the background.

Mig is convinced that Aunt Maria must be a witch, but who will believe her? Maybe the ghost who haunts the downstairs bedroom holds the key . . .?
